Description:


CRCC is looking to add a part-time center-based BCBA to our growing ABA Program at our Omaha NW Center (88th & Blondo). The position is Monday-Friday, working 12-30 hours per week. There will be some light travel between the Omaha NW and the SW Center and going to schools. You will have a small caseload size of clients. This position will provide support to staff, clients, and families by coordinating and providing services in Applied Behavior Analysis, function analyses and assessment, behavior acquisition and reduction procedures, and adaptive life skills.

Requirements:


Essential Functions/Responsibilities:

  • Provides initial and ongoing training and guidance to behavioral staff and clients;
  • Provides direct supervision for development and implementation of behavioral assessments and treatment protocols for clients;
  • Provides model teaching and other direct instructional supports including but not limited to practicum supervision/teaching, and in-service instruction to other support professionals;
  • Develops and implements assessment tools to conduct functional assessments and analyses when appropriate to develop appropriate behavior strategies to teach appropriate behavior;
  • Develops behavior plans for clients with a focus on teaching and other antecedent strategies to reduce problematic behaviors;
  • Supports administration needs including managing and supervising Behavioral Technicians;
  • Communicates with teachers and aids to provide guidance related to the behavioral needs of clients;
  • Supports client and classroom staff needs with data collection, analysis systems, graphing, preparing materials, and research activities for programs;
  • Implements and monitors ongoing clinical and research activities in accordance with needs identified;
  • Provides billing with necessary documents and is responsive to requests;
  • Maintains all data, paperwork, and communication between staff and families to provide ongoing feedback including applicable reporting to regulatory agencies.

Knowledge and Abilities:

  • Master’s degree in Behavior Analysis, Special Education, Psychology, or related human services field;
  • Successful completion of field work hours in the analysis of behavior and instructional strategies training related to working with clients who have pervasive developmental disorders, their caregivers, and when applicable, other agencies working with clients;
  • Certified as a BCBA; minimum of three years experience required as a BCBA;
  • Completion of 8-hour supervision training based on the Supervisor Training Curriculum Outline (2.0) before provision supervision;
  • Maintains continuing education requirements for BCBA credential;
  • Knowledge of trial-based programming and implementation;
  • One year working with children or adolescents/adults with developmental disabilities in an education, instructional, or therapeutic setting;
  • Ability to provide, assess, interpret, and communicate client-specific data (in response to treatment protocols);
  • Ability to demonstrate professional behavior by adhering to departmental and organizational policies and procedures, and assuming authority appropriately;
  • Must pursue education or training necessary to perform at the level of competence required to incorporate the hardware, software, technologies, and ideas relevant to specific job responsibilities;
  • Must be able to demonstrate the delivery of services at a level of excellence;
  • Demonstrated competence across all age groups due to the diversity of the children and families;
  • Possess understanding, patience, and flexibility in dealing with clients, parents, and team members;
  • Willing to increase knowledge in fields of endeavor;
  • Able to read and understand written plans;
  • Able to lift up to fifty pounds and practice 2 person lifting for clients over 50 pounds or when necessary;
  • Able to meet conditions of employment regarding health status and clearance with the Nebraska Child Abuse/Neglect Central Registry and/or Adult Abuse/Neglect Registry, Nebraska State Patrol, criminal history check and fingerprinting.
